Once you have the idea of creating your own game, the next question that comes up is: “How much will it cost?”. In fact, it depends on many factors that should be taken into account to determine video game development costs. In this article, we will look at some of the most important factors that will be decisive in determining the final cost of developing a game.
For many novice developers, the question often arises: how much to make a mobile game? There is no definitively simple answer to this question because you need to find out what the game will be like and what it means to ‘make’ it. The shortest answer would be that the cost of creating a game ranges from $0 to $300 million. Yes, it is difficult to call it a definite answer to the question, so we should go deeper.
To begin with, anyone can (practically) create a game for free using some of the free tools that are available on the Internet. Such a game can be considered created for $0, if you do not take into account the time spent, computer power and the Internet.
On the other hand, the cost of the most advanced and famous games is about 200-300 million dollars. This price matches the cost of a huge development team that has been working for many years, office costs, software, outsourcing, taxes, and more. Obviously, such a game can be called high-class and requiring considerable costs.

Next, we look at the average cost of creating each type of game. Despite the fact that game development costs depend on many factors, we can name an approximate range.
As the experience of most successful indie games shows, development often requires an amount in the range of $50,000 to $750,000. This amount may be less if the same developer has been working on the game for several years. As the development team grows, so does the cost of the game. Independent publishers expect the game to cost half a million dollars to develop. However, the publisher may increase the amount to increase the marketing budget, game details and testing. Depending on the number of platforms on which the game will be available, the cost of the publisher may also vary.
Game development process triple A games can usually cost tens or hundreds of millions of dollars. Games of this magnitude are created by a considerable team of developers over several years. For example, the Call of Duty series of games is being developed simultaneously by three large studios, each of which spends a lot of money on development. In addition to development expenses, a huge budget will be spent on production and distribution of CDs, marketing, advertising, and much more.

With mobile games, the situation is slightly different, as the cost of games will be completely different. Mobile games are usually created for the App Store or Google Play. Mobile game development costs range from $5,000 for simple mini-games to $200,000 for more complex multiplayer games. Prices may also vary depending on what game features will be presented. It is also worth considering that the development of games for iPhones is usually more expensive than for Android.
An average mobile game with around 50,000 downloads with a good monetization model can expect to earn $12,000-$13,000. The more downloads a game has, the more revenue it can generate. Furthermore, in-game transactions bring additional profit to the game studio.
